🤍 I survived #twoundertwo , I remember having my baby in September 2019 and going back to work 4 weeks later in October 2019 … I’m going to be honest being a #sahm was just not in the cards for me. I wasn’t married, I didn’t have my own place, I technically wasn’t even in a relationship with their daddy. Yes we had somewhere to stay where I could’ve been without a job for a while with no pressure and expectations (I must always acknowledge my support system) I could’ve even went to school but my mental health couldn’t handle kids 24/7 or not having my OWN money.. being a SAHM is a job that literally never ends, you never get a break from. (So me personally unless that opportunity presents itself with childcare and a Hefty monthly allowance it’s a no for me)

🤍 My babies have grown so much over the years ! I wouldn’t trade them for anything in the world. I’ve grown and changed so much over the years. I had my moments of outside almost every night, drinking til I pass out during the day, but I made it through. I’m better. I’m still growing, I’m still transforming and still trying to learn my way through #motherhood .
